Why Crusher Noise Needs Control

Industrial crushers generate extreme noise levels of 95-115+ dB(A) from the repeated impact and compression of rock, ore, and aggregate material. Impact crushers and hammer mills are the noisiest, producing high-intensity impulsive noise that is particularly hazardous to hearing. Crusher houses in mining and cement plants frequently exceed permissible noise exposure limits, and the noise propagates across the plant boundary affecting surrounding communities.

How ARK Solves Crusher Noise

ARK designs robust acoustic enclosures for crushers that are purpose-built for the extreme operating conditions of crushing facilities — heavy vibration, dust, material spillage, and high ambient temperatures. Our enclosures use impact-resistant outer skins and mass-loaded composite panels to attenuate both the broadband and impulsive noise components. The enclosure accommodates feed chutes, discharge conveyors, and dust extraction ductwork with acoustically sealed penetrations.

Typical Specifications

Noise Reduction15-35 dB(A)
Panel Thickness100-200 mm
PenetrationsFeed chute, conveyor, dust extraction — acoustically sealed
AccessLarge removable panels & overhead crane access
MaterialsHeavy-gauge MS / wear-resistant steel with acoustic infill
